Buying a property is a major investment, and it's important to protect your investment from unforeseen problems. This is where title insurance comes in. It provides legal protection against claims on the property that could jeopardize your ownership.

A title search discovers any existing problems with the title. If some issues are found, title insurance can help cover the expenses associated with clearing them.

This policy is typically expected by lenders and provides confidence that your real estate investment is safe.

What Is the Difference Between Title and Homeowner's Insurance

When purchasing a home, it's crucial to understand the distinction between title insurance and homeowner's insurance. Even though both provide financial protection, they safeguard against different risks. Title insurance safeguards your ownership rights by protecting against claims of unknown liens on the property. Homeowner's insurance, on the other hand, covers damages to your home and belongings from events such as fire, theft, or natural disasters.

  • Think title insurance as a one-time fee that ensures clear ownership.
  • Homeowner's insurance is an annual plan that provides ongoing protection.

By recognizing the differences between these two types of insurance, you can make informed decisions to protect your investment effectively.
